Responsibilities- Implement the sms chat channel for Zoom Contact Center.
- Assess the task from PM/UX and give feedback from a technical perspective.
- Perform DB/Architecture design.
- Implement test scripts for backend API.
- Troubleshoot production issues and perform fix or enhancement.
- Implement scheduled call back related features.
- Design and implement service monitoring system.
- Requires a Master’s degree in Computer Science, Management and Systems, a related field, or a foreign degree equivalent.
- Must have 1 year of experience in the job offered or a related occupation.
- Must have 1 year of experience in Core Java, Java Spring Boot, AWS – Amazon Web Service, Restful API, Microservice Framework, Kubernetes, Database SQL, and Python.
- Telecommuting work arrangement permitted: position may work in various unanticipated locations throughout the U.S.
- Position does not require domestic or international travel.
